Hentaika Jul 5, 2023 @ 8:51am 
How you should use it depends on what is your goal in game.

If your goal is to simply beat game ASAP - keep only the most expensive fishes and sell everything else to maximize profit.

If your goal is some completionism like every dish level 10 then you should always keep 2 of each fish(and more of the more rare ones if density allows) and send to kitchen the remainder., ideally 3 star and sell everything else. Once dish is maxed - you can butcher or sell the remainder of that fish if you wish.

The main trick is that as long as density is below 100%(99% or lower) - you will be able to multiply any amount of new fish just fine as there is no limit to how much you can overkill the density.
My record is ~320% density.

My usual daily routine is to check on fishes every morning and lower fish density to ~99% while making sure to keep 2 of each fish I need and for the most rare fish I try to let them stack to at least ~8.

Do 3 star fish breed more 3 star fish? If you sell all 2 star fish and leave the 3 star to breed will you get stead supply of nothing but 3 star?
Hentaika Jul 5, 2023 @ 12:15pm 
Originally posted by Honorable_D:
Do 3 star fish breed more 3 star fish? If you sell all 2 star fish and leave the 3 star to breed will you get stead supply of nothing but 3 star?
From my tests the 2 stars seem to never produce 3 stars. Either that or they are super rare. Left some huge stacks of only 2 stars and they only ever produced more 2 stars.
3 stars can still produce 2 stars but seem to have chance for 3 stars.
